QuoteWelcome to the Faction Change page! This service lets you change a character's faction from Alliance to Horde or from Horde to Alliance. A mandatory opposite-faction race change is part of the faction change process, and the full range of customization options offered by the Character Re-Customization service is included as well. Each faction change costs $30.00 USD.
Things to know before you start:

    * The faction change process is not immediate, and a character will not be available for play while a faction change is pending. Under normal conditions the process should take under an hour, but please allow up to several days for a faction change to complete.
    * During this process, you will select a new character race from the opposite-faction races that have the character's class available. You cannot change a character's class.
    * To see how character-specific information such as achievements, reputations, and items are affected by a faction change, refer to the Translation Table.
    * A realm transfer is not included in a faction change. However, the restriction on having members of both factions on a PvP realm has been lifted, so you can have characters of both factions on a single PvP realm.
    * A character can change factions once every 60 days.
    * Not every character will be eligible to undergo a faction change. If applicable, the reason a character is not eligible will be brought to your attention before payment is rendered. For example, faction changes may not be possible on certain realms or only one "direction" of faction changes may be allowed on a given realm.

A few points of interest from the FAQ ...

QuoteWill this service allow me to customize a character and select a different name once its faction has been changed?

Yes.  Each Faction Change purchase will also provide the target character with an included re-customization and optional name change.

Meaning you can change their sex as well as everything else that goes with the $15 recustomization option we already had.

QuoteWhat will happen to the character's non-combat pets when I change its faction?

Non-combat pets will not be affected by this process and will be available once the character's faction change completes. This even includes faction-specific non-combat pets.

I can only think of one, and that's the faerie drake thing from an alliance-only quest outside of Dire Maul. Hm.

QuoteWhat will happen to the character's Armory profile?

Once you have completed the Faction Change process, the character's Armory profile will be updated to reflect any faction, racial, gender, or name changes. Please note that our Armory system is still in beta at this time, so the character's profile may not immediately display the updated information.

From the transfer table linked above ... it shows what mounts turn into what when the faction changes. This was interesting ...
QuoteAncient Frostsaber   <->       *Random Discontinued Epic Mount
Black Nightsaber      <->       * Random Discontinued Epic Mount

* If you own one of the discontinued epic mounts (Ivory Raptor, Ancient Frostsaber, etc) and you transfer to a race without discontinued mounts, you will be given a random discontinued mount from another race on your new faction.
Quote
Hearthstone

After a faction change, a character's hearthstone is automatically set to the inn inside the capital city of their new race, which is also where they re-enter the game world as a member of the opposite faction
